The cobot end effector is a type of equipment installed at the end of the collaborative robotic arm. It is that part of the cobot, which interacts with the environment and accomplishes a given task. They are actuated hydraulically, electrically, mechanically or pneumatically, and are available in different sizes and shapes. There are various types of end effectors such as grippers, force-torque sensors, material removal tools, welding torches, collision sensors, and tool changers. They are widely used in tasks such as pick, move and place dry or prepreg reinforcements. Also, they used to meet industrial process requirements such as painting, welding, inspection, assembly, and machine tending among others.

Market Dynamics and Trends:

The prime factor fueling the growth of cobot end effector market is the adoption of collaborative robots in heavy and non-heavy industries owing to the increasing popularity of industry automation principles like Industry 4.0. Collaborative robots possess huge potential in industries as they can interact directly and safely with humans in a shared work place certified according to the ISO / TS 15066 standard. Also, cobots provide high return on investments (ROI), and benefits to companies of all sizes in terms of overall competitiveness, productivity and product quality.
The end effectors of current times are becoming smarter and more potent as machine learning software coupled with various safety features are increasingly being integrated within the End-of-Arm Tooling (EOAT). Also, development of machine vision provides them the ability to adapt to changing environments. Such higher level of technological sophistication, along with the rise in automation across various industries to carry out activities faster have led to increased demand for cobot end effectors market.
However, cost of collaborative robots fitted with end effectors and their installation charges are very high. Also, interoperability issues, like the difficulty of integrating different cobot frameworks with existing facilities is expected to limit the cobot end effector market growth during the forecast period. On the other hand, the advancement and development of HRC (Human Machine Collaboration) grippers is expected to provide lucrative opportunities for the market players in the coming years.

Competitive Landscape :
Lucrative growth opportunities make the cobot end effector market extremely competitive. Some of the major players in the market are ABB, Destaco, Kuka Ag, Millibar, Inc., Piab Ab, Robotiq, Schmalz, Toyota Industries Corporation, Weiss Robotics Gmbh & Co. Kg, and Zimmer Group. Strategic alliances, acquisitions and innovations along with various R&D activities are key strategies adopted by the market players to maintain their dominance in the market. For instance, in February 2021, ABB Ltd launched GoFa and SWIFTI collaborative robots that offer higher payload and speed to complement its YuMi series, with an aim to accelerate its effort to provide factory automation in high-growth segments, including electronics, health, consumer products, logistics and food & beverages. Also, in February 2021, Destaco launched TC1 Manual tool changing device which can be used for picking & placing and loading & unloading applications. The tool provides seamless integration for fast tool change operation, thereby expanding the flexibility of cobots.
